After the controversial launch of Battlefield 2042, EA is making major changes to bring the series back to its roots. Battlefield 2026 will feature:

  • A modern-day setting – No more WWI, WWII, or futuristic themes.
  • Massive multiplayer battles – With a refined focus on 64-player matches.
  • A dedicated single-player campaign – Developed separately for the first time in years.
  • Enhanced destruction mechanics – Building on the best features from Battlefield 3 & 4.

EA has also introduced Battlefield Labs, a player-testing initiative that will allow early playtests to fine-tune core mechanics before launch.

Battlefield Studios – The Teams Behind the Game

To ensure Battlefield 2026 is a massive success, EA has assigned development across four studios:

  • DICE (Sweden): Leading multiplayer development and core gameplay mechanics.
  • Motive (Canada): Developing the single-player campaign and multiplayer maps.
  • Ripple Effect (USA): Focused on attracting new players and onboarding mechanics.
  • Criterion (UK): Dedicated to expanding the campaign experience.

This multi-studio approach ensures that each aspect of the game receives the attention and polish it deserves.

Battlefield Labs – EA’s Player-Driven Innovation

Battlefield Labs – EA’s Player-Driven Innovation

EA has introduced Battlefield Labs, a new community-driven testing system that will allow select players to:

  • Play pre-alpha versions of the game.
  • Test new game mechanics, destruction, and weapons.
  • Provide real-time feedback to shape development.

Key Takeaways:

  • Destruction will be a major focus – Expect a return to fully destructible environments.
  • Classic modes like Conquest & Breakthrough will remain – But with player-driven refinements.
  • Class-based gameplay returns – No more Specialists; instead, expect a refined Assault, Engineer, Support, and Recon system.

EA is actively listening to feedback, aiming to win back the trust of Battlefield veterans.

Gameplay – A Return to Battlefield’s Golden Age

Battlefield 2026 is expected to deliver a gameplay experience closer to Battlefield 3 & 4, considered by many to be the franchise’s peak.

What’s Confirmed:

  • No more 128-player maps – The game will stick to 64-player battles for better balance.
  • Improved destruction mechanics – Inspired by Battlefield Bad Company 2.
  • More immersive vehicle combat – With helicopters, jets, and naval warfare returning.
  • Environmental hazards & dynamic events – Including firestorms and collapsing structures.

The game will also refine gunplay and movement mechanics, ensuring a more fluid and tactical combat experience.

Battlefield 2026’s Single-Player Campaign – A True Comeback

Battlefield 2026’s Single-Player Campaign – A True Comeback?

For the first time in years, Battlefield 2026 will feature a fully developed single-player campaign.

What We Know:

  • Motive Studio is leading development – Known for their work on Dead Space Remake.
  • No live-service elements – A complete story-driven experience.
  • Inspired by Battlefield: Bad Company – Featuring destructible environments and squad-based gameplay.

Unlike past Battlefield games, where single-player felt tacked on, EA is fully committing to a high-quality solo experience.

What Went Wrong with Battlefield 2042 – Lessons Learned

EA has acknowledged that Battlefield 2042 made critical mistakes, which Battlefield 2026 will correct.

Key Fixes in Battlefield 2026:

  • ? No more Specialists – Returning to the traditional class system.
  • ? Smaller, more focused maps – Instead of overly ambitious 128-player chaos.
  • ? Refined gunplay & destruction – No more arcade-style mechanics.

Battlefield 2026 is being built to restore trust, ensuring that longtime fans feel at home.

Battlefield 2026 Release Date & Platforms

Battlefield 2026 Release Date & Platforms

EA has not confirmed an exact release date, but has stated that Battlefield 2026 will launch between April 2025 and March 2026.

Expected Platforms:

  • ✅ PlayStation 5
  • ✅ Xbox Series X|S
  • ✅ PC
  • No PlayStation 4 or Xbox One support – A true next-gen Battlefield experience.

This marks Battlefield’s first fully next-gen release, leveraging high-end graphics, improved physics, and immersive sound design.
